Does anyone else do this? In view of so much theft, deception, and for the safety of all, including myself, I have decided to fingerprint everyone I notarize for, Ack or Jurat. Does anyone else do this?

I ask everyone for their thumbprint and, so far, no one has refused.
Please remember that in California we can only require prints for deeds, quitclaim deeds and deeds of trust affecting l property.
We must not refuse to notarize any other docs if the signer refuses their prints.
